
Cost of Enclosed Porch Construction in Richmond
Constructing an enclosed porch in Richmond, VA, can be a fantastic investment, providing additional living space and enhancing the value of your home. However, the cost of such a project can vary widely based on several factors. Understanding these factors and the common tasks involved can help you plan your budget more effectively.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Size of the Porch: Larger porches require more materials and labor, increasing the overall cost.
- Materials Used: High-end materials like hardwood or composite decking are more expensive than basic options like treated lumber.
- Design Complexity: Custom designs with intricate details and unique features can drive up costs.
- Type of Enclosure: Options range from simple screened porches to fully insulated sunrooms, with costs varying accordingly.
- Labor Costs: Skilled labor rates in Richmond, VA, can impact the total expenditure significantly.
-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may require permits and inspections, adding to the cost.
- Foundation Work: Additional work on the foundation, such as leveling or reinforcing, can increase expenses.
- Utilities Installation: Adding electrical outlets, lighting, or HVAC systems will raise the overall cost.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(Richmond, VA) |
---|---|
Basic Screened Porch | $5,000 - $10,000 |
Three-Season Room | $10,000 - $20,000 |
Four-Season Room/Sunroom | $20,000 - $35,000 |
Custom Design and Features | $25,000 - $50,000 |
Electrical Work | $500 - $2,000 |
HVAC Installation | $2,000 - $5,000 |
Foundation Work | $1,500 - $5,000 |
Permits and Inspections | $500 - $1,500 |
